on windows client, we backup an Oracle DB with catalog. It's backup about 1,6Tb and last week i found two of four jobs still writing but hanging. I've stopped the backup, and on ..\user_ops\dbext\logs there are 4 .lock files like this:
vxbsa.01651564654.23215.5151.files.1.lock
If i remember, when backup finish these lock files are canceled. I requested at dba admin to check rman session hangings and then i retried the backup. Now i have 8 lock files.
How i can resolve this issue?
I think that the lock still there, backup will fail.
